Withdrawal and Transfer Procedures

OPTION 1:     TRANSFER
Athletes can transfer their race entry according to the Race Transfer Policy below

Athletes inspire new Ironman Race Transfer Policy
The World Triathlon Corporation introduces a new “Race Transfer Policy” for all European and South African Ironman and Ironman 70.3 races. This initiative has been shaped by the opinions of hundreds of Ironman athletes.

Effective immediately, the World Triathlon Corporation (WTC) will substantially change its withdrawal policy for all European and South African Ironman and Ironman 70.3 races. For an administration fee of 29 Euro, athletes can transfer their race entry regardless of their reason, and all athletes already entered, or signing up for an Ironman and Ironman 70.3 race prior to December 31st 2011 are automatically enrolled.

“We are offering athletes who can’t make it to a race they originally signed up for a unique chance to still fulfill their dream of finishing an Ironman or Ironman 70.3 in the very same year by choosing an alternate race”, says Stefan Petschnig, Executive Manager WTC for Europe and South Africa.

Feedback from athletes was crucial in shaping the new withdrawal policy. “The response we got took us by storm. Athletes are obviously very passionate about this and hundreds of them talked to us on Facebook and via e-Mail. We strongly believe that the views of our athletes are the most important thing for us moving forward, and we will apply the same procedure to further decisions. “We understand that athletes entrust us with their special day that they have spent months training for. Two new members of our staff will assist athletes with their transfers, to make the procedure as easy for them as possible. We are actually planning another – global – initiative that’ll bring us back to talking to athletes via Social Media”, Petschnig adds.

WTC’s existing policy which allows for an athlete’s cancellation of a race remains untouched by the new program.

Race Transfer Policy / Rules

• all athletes that sign up for an Ironman or Ironman 70.3 race in Europe or South Africa before December 31st 2011 are automatically enrolled. Athletes can still withdraw and receive a refund according to the existing rules. However, the race entries can now be transferred up until two months prior to the date of the race the athlete originally signed up for.

• it is not possible to transfer an entry more than once. Race entry transfers are 29 Euro regardless of the reason for the athlete’s transfer.

• entries for races before August 25th 2012 can only be transferred to races within the same calendar year. Entries for races after August 25th (Ironman 70.3 Ireland) can be transferred to any race prior to June 30th 2013.

• race entries cannot be transferred to any sold-out Ironman or Ironman 70.3 event.

• upgrades between Ironman 70.3 and Ironman races are possible, the fee of 29 Euro and the difference in the entry fee will be charged.

• it is also possible to downgrade a race, although the difference in entry fee will not be refunded.

• race entries cannot be transferred to another athlete.

Ironman 70.3 Antwerp is not included in this policy

Race Transfer Policy” / Step By Step

• athletes download the electronic withdrawal form to be found on the event website. They need to complete it and send it to withdrawal@ironman.com

• athletes opting for a transfer will pay 29 Euro and receive a code that’ll allow them to sign up for an alternate race. In case of an upgrade or a difference in entry fees athletes will receive the code after paying for the transfer and the entry fee difference.

OPTION 2:    WITHDRAWAL

Athletes can withdraw and cancel their race entry subject to the following refund rates.

Cancellation notices received:
Until May 2nd, 2012: 50% refund
Until July 2nd, 2012: 25% refund
After July 2nd, 2012: no refunds will be given.

This policy is not dependant on circumstances and is final.

If you need to withdraw your entry or want to transfer please download the transfer/withdrawal form, complete it and return it to withdrawal@ironman.com for processing.

NB Special products such as extra tickets, DVDs or VIP-Tickets will be refunded until April 17th from April 18th the special products are not refundable.
It is not possible to defer your entry to another year or another athlete. The 5% Active fee is non-refundable.
Your withdrawal will be confirmed via email and can take up to 28 days to process
Refunds are credited back to the card with which you originally paid.

About the event

The event begins with a 1.9K swim in the crystal-clear waters of Galway Bay before athletes take on a challenging 90K bike course. With a spectator-friendly run course through the Salthill area of Galway.
